I'm just wondering if there is some sort of unseen pitfall with rethreading a stock TRG 42 in 300 wm from metric threads to 5/8x24?

What I've researched here says there isn't, but a " please don't do it" response to a request for info from a supplier of TRG accessories has me wondering. It is just threads right?
 
If you are already set up for 5/8 muzzle devices then go ahead. However if you are not then the 18X1 are IMO a better thread. The 18X1 is larger in diameter and more thread engagement there for stronger. I just dont see why we use a heavier profile barrels for their rigidity then attach a suppressor with such a small shank.
